问题:使用select2更新数据
答案:select2是一个基于jQuery的自定义下拉选择框插件。它提供了更好的用户体验和更多的功能选项,可以帮助开发者创建功能强大的下拉选择框。
select2的更新数据可以通过以下几种方式实现:
- 通过ajax动态加载数据:可以使用select2的ajax选项来实现动态加载数据。在用户输入内容时,可以通过ajax请求从后端获取数据并更新下拉选项。具体实现可以参考select2的官方文档中的Ajax部分:select2 ajax。在腾讯云上,你可以使用腾讯云提供的云函数(SCF)来处理后端逻辑,详情请参考腾讯云云函数文档:云函数(SCF)。
- 使用JavaScript动态更新数据:可以通过JavaScript代码动态更新select2的数据。例如,使用jQuery的
append
方法向select2中添加新的选项,或者使用remove
方法移除现有的选项。具体实现可以参考select2的官方文档中的Programmatic Control部分:select2 programmatic control。 - 利用select2的data方法更新数据:可以使用select2的
data
方法来更新已有的下拉选项。通过修改数据源对象中的数据,然后调用data
方法进行更新。具体实现可以参考select2的官方文档中的Data部分:select2 data。
针对不同的应用场景,腾讯云也提供了一系列适用的产品来支持开发者使用select2更新数据:
- 如果你的应用需要大规模存储和访问数据,推荐使用腾讯云的对象存储服务 COS(Cloud Object Storage),详情请参考:腾讯云对象存储 COS。
- 如果你需要在应用中进行音视频处理,推荐使用腾讯云的音视频处理服务 VOD(Video on Demand),详情请参考:腾讯云音视频处理 VOD。
- 如果你的应用需要使用人工智能技术,推荐使用腾讯云的人工智能服务 AI(Artificial Intelligence),详情请参考:腾讯云人工智能 AI。
请注意,以上提到的腾讯云产品仅作为参考,具体选择产品应根据实际需求进行评估和决策。